Azerbaijan is unique in the Muslim world for its extreme secularism, a legacy of Soviet rule. While the population is majority Shia Muslim, religious laws do not govern the state. However, Islam remains a powerful force in regulating social morality, particularly regarding women’s sexuality.

There is often a significant social double standard regarding sexual behavior. While men may face little to no social repercussions for having multiple partners, women who do the sameβ€”or are perceived to do soβ€”face severe social stigma, ostracization, and labeling. It would be a mistake to view Azerbaijani women solely as victims. The country has a high literacy rate, and women dominate certain sectors like education and medicine (80% of teachers and 66% of doctors are women). The government has passed laws on gender equality and domestic violence.
